Decoupling Dilemmas: U.S.-China Relations

This chapter explores the contentious debate over whether the U.S. should decouple economically from China, examining the contrasting perspectives on military readiness, financial repercussions, and the implications for global alliances. The discussion highlights the intricate balance between economic interdependence and strategic decision-making, emphasizing the potential risks of alienating allies while addressing Chinese aggression. Key issues such as cybersecurity, intellectual property theft, and the historical dynamics between the nations are analyzed to better understand the complexities of this crucial relationship.
